Resmini, Ronald Joseph was born on June 16, 1942 in Providence. Son of Joseph Andrew and Corrine Marie (Barrette) Resmini.
Bachelor, Providence College, 1965; Juris Doctor, Suffolk U., 1968.
Substitute teacher, public schools, Cranston, Providence, Rhode Island, 1968-1969;
law clerk to justice, Rhode Island Supreme Court, Providence, 1971;
private practice, Providence, since 1981. Member of faculty Rhode Island Trial Institute, 1988-1989. Instructor business law Roger Williams U., Providence, 1969-1973.
Assistant town solicitor Town of Coventry (Rhode Island), 1970-1972. Lecturer continuing legal education program Rhode Island Bar Association, since 1978. Lecturer Roger William School Law, 1996.
Instructor Rhode Island Law Institute. Member Rhode Island Continuing Legal Education Committee, 1992. Lecturer personal injury National Business Institute, 1988.
Board of directors Providence chapter American Red Cross, 1974-1978. Campaign finance chairman for R.I.atty. general, 1986. Coach Barrington (Rhode Island) Little League, 1988, 93, 94, 95.
Coach Senior League and All Stars, 1990, 91, 92, 93, 94. Soccer coach McDonald's All Stars, 1995. President Parent-Child Indian Guide Organisation, Barrington Young Men’s Christian Association, 1988.
Eucharistic minister St. Lukes, Orchard View Nursing Home. Served to captain United States Army, 1969-1971. United States Army Reserve, 1971-1977, retired.
Fellow Rhode Island Bar Foundation. Member Interest Lawyer's Trust Accounts (founder, chairman 1984), Rhode Island Trial Lawyers Association (treasurer 1975-1985, Board of Governors since 1986), National Board Trial Advocacy (board examiner 1990), University Club, Rhode Island Country Club, Turks Head Club, Crestwood Country Club.
Married Paula Oliver, July 1, 1979. Children: R. Jason, Adam Joseph, Andrew Oliver.
